Caption: Hollywood magic was at work Thursday afternoon as a dingy Boston gym was transformed into Las Vegas’ Caesar’s Palace to re-enact the memorable Mickey Ward vs. Alfonso Sanchez battle from April 12, 1997. Mark Wahlberg looked to be in amazing shape as he danced around the ring and exchanged blows with the actor playing Sanchez, real life boxer Miguel Espino. Wahlberg received some movie boxing advice from director David O. Russell when his punches started getting too strong and later was dressed with makeup to make it look like he had received a beating. The fight being recreated had Wahlberg’s Ward getting beat to a bloody pulp before taking control in the 7th round with his signature devastating body blow, knocking Sanchez out cold. It was a major comeback for Ward after 3 years out of the ring working construction and manual labor.

The Lexington Flick movie theater was closed last night for the filming of “The Fighter,’’ the biopic about Lowell boxer “Irish” Micky Ward. Actor Mark Wahlberg, who plays Ward in the film, and Amy Adams, who costars as his girlfriend, were working at the Mass. Ave. cinema well into the evening, filming in front of the Flick building and in one of its screening rooms. “The Fighter,’’ which costars Christian Bale, wraps next Wednesday.

Actor Mark Wahlberg is to launch a fantastic new online auction today, August 18, to raise money for The Mark Wahlberg Youth Foundation.

The auction will feature three lots: the chance for two people to play a round of golf with Wahlberg at a top golf course; the opportunity to join Entourage’s Adrian Grenier for a round of golf in Los Angeles; and a private batting lesson with baseball legend David Ortiz.

The Mark Wahlberg Youth Foundation aims to improve the quality of life for inner city youth through a working partnership with other youth organizations. The Foundation provides financial and community support to assist in making the dreams and ultimate potential of inner city youth become a reality.

Mark Wahlberg was rushed to hospital after inhaling smoke on the set of his latest movie.

According to RadarOnline.com, The Italian Job star was taken to Massachusetts General Hospital after a mishap while filming The Fighter.

“Mark was working on a scene where a smoke machine was being used for atmosphere and apparently he breathed in too much smoke,” a source said.

“When he woke up the next morning he was gasping for breath, so he was taken to Massachusetts General Hospital where he was put on a breathing device that helped clear his lungs.”

Wahlberg was released from hospital and back at work the same day.
